One thing to note is that SF's population swells greatly during the day [1] as people commute into the city for work (Less than before the pandemic, but still substantial). So per-capita crime might still not be the best metric to use because it would be misleading. [1] "San Francisco leads the Bay Area in attracting the most workers from outside its boundaries, with a net inflow of more than 200,000 commuters each day" https://vitalsigns.mtc.ca.gov/indicators/commute-patterns |
